Hugh was born August 4, 1932 in Washington, … WebHugh Granville Robinson(August 4, 1932 - March 1, 2010) was the first African Americangeneral officer in the United States Army Corps of Engineersand a decorated veteran of the Vietnam War. Robinson served as the military aide to President Lyndon B. Johnson, the first African American to hold such a position. Johnson, he was … broken sim card readerWebThe Southwestern Division, U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, was created in 1937, as a result of large and catastrophic flood events that led up to Congress passing the Flood Control Act of 1936. That Act recognized that flood control was a federal responsibility and authorized 211 flood control projects in 31 states. brokensilenze the ms pat show
